Output 1326084699d3f63a22973bee91c78c3c500aeab58d4fd71783ee62f964533980:0

value
1633579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15c171651ab53c955ffbdac566e5369f19dd1b72 OP_EQUAL
address
33g3rDwWnGAXoLNqZJnbTMea9Q2jU4EBzM
transaction
1326084699d3f63a22973bee91c78c3c500aeab58d4fd71783ee62f964533980
spent
true